Abstract
The utility model discloses a plastic sealing structure of an ignition coil. The ignition coil comprises a casing, a coil and an iron core, wherein the coil is wound on the iron core and then placed in the casing which is provided with an opening. The plastic sealing structure is characterized in that a support is arranged at the position of the opening of the casing, and epoxy resin is poured at the position of the support to enable the casing to be in a completely-sealed state. The plastic sealing structure can effectively improve plastic sealing strength at the position of the opening of the casing, enables a plastic seal at the position of the opening to not easy to crack, and prolongs service life of the ignition coil accordingly.

Background technology
Ignition coil on the motor vehicle is a kind of transformer that can produce the required high pressure of igniting, all comprises housing, winding, iron core basically, winding on the iron core after; Be sealed in the housing; An opening is set on the housing, be wound with the iron core of winding in installation after, need this opening is sealed.What often adopt at present is directly poured with epoxy resin to be sealed it at opening part.Because the epoxy resin that cast is a large amount of, its intensity is not high, and in use easy of crack causes ignition coil to scrap, the useful life of the ignition coil of shortening.

Embodiment
With reference to accompanying drawing; The envelope of this ignition coil is moulded structure, and its ignition coil comprises housing 2, winding 1 and iron core 3, and wherein winding 1 is placed in the said housing 2 on iron core 3; Said housing 2 has opening part; The opening part of said housing 2 is provided with support 4, and waters with epoxy resin at support 4 places, makes shell 2 bodies be in full closeding state.Before casting epoxy resin, support 4 is set, during earlier just as building; Before the cast concrete, arrange that earlier reinforcing bar is the same, concrete intensity is greatly enhanced; The utility model too, its intensity of the epoxy resin of cast also is greatly improved, thereby in long-term use; It is not easy to crack to seal the epoxy resin of moulding the place, makes housing 2 airtight for a long time, to improve the useful life of ignition coil.Said support 4 is netted, and this network 4 can have mean allocation as skeleton when casting epoxy resin, and the effect of moulding on the intensity in the raising envelope is optimal.
